Tuesday June 18th @ the Make It Up Club

This week's edition of MIUC features a large collection of some of the most vibrant and exciting young soundmakers engaging with the spontaneous music idiom in our fair city at the moment, including some diasporic dudes who have not graced the Bar Open stage in some time. The Phonetic Orchestra was created by Jon Heilbron (who has spent the past year expanding his sonic palette in Berlin) as a vehicle to explore contemporary approaches to composition, improvisation and non-standard notation systems. On Tuesday they will present two sets of somewhat-structured aleatoric interaction, and one example of absolute electroacoustic disenthrallment, and with the likes of the undermentioned performers this is certainly one night improv lovers will not want to miss. 

Jon Heilbron - Bass
Ida Duelund Hansen - Bass
Matthias Schack-Arnott - Percussion
Calum G'Froerer - Trumpet
Reuben Lewis - Trumpet
Brett Thompson - Guitar
Giles Warren - Guitar
Tom Stewart-Toner - Guitar
Sam Hall - Drums
James McLean - Drums
Jon Smeathers - Electronics
Jenny Barnes – Voice
